(250) 825-4063; e-mail: [email protected] April 2019 East Kootenay bighorn sheep surveys 2019 Executive summary To support management of bighorn sheep (Ovis canadensis) in the East Kootenay we conducted aerial sheep surveys within 8 Population Management Units (PMUs) during January-February 2019. We used 38.9 hours of helicopter time and flew 27.6 hours on survey. We observed 1,246 bighorn sheep in 151 groups during surveys. Using the standardized 80% sightability correction factor to the aerial survey count then added additional animals from ground counts not accounted for during aerial surveys, a total of 1,596 sheep were estimated within the survey area. Estimated lamb:ewe ratios were >30 lambs:100 ewes in all PMUs and averaged 41:100 overall. Estimated ram ratios ranged from 35–85 rams:100 ewes and averaged 50:100 overall. We used a sightability model to obtain an estimate of 1,648 (±150 ][90% CI]) sheep. The model calculated an overall average sightability of 0.77; sightability was lowest for Class IV rams (0.68). These inventory data fed into the Kootenay Region bighorn sheep management plan process being completed in 2019. Number of bighorn sheep and mountain goats observed during aerial surveys in Elk Valley West from 1981 to 2019. ............................................................................................................................ 13 Aurora Wildlife Research Page iv East Kootenay bighorn sheep surveys 2019 Introduction Periodic inventories of harvested ungulates are required for population and harvest management. We conducted aerial surveys for bighorn sheep (Ovis canadensis) in the East Kootenay during late January to late February 2019 to update population estimates and provide current abundance data for the concurrent regional bighorn sheep management planning process. Teck Coal Ltd. did not conduct wildlife inventories within the Elk Valley East this winter, however in support of the Sparwood and District Fish and Wildlife Association’s wildlife programs did contribute funding towards this inventory. Study area Many of the known winter ranges in the East Kootenay were included in the study, including the following Population Management Units (PMU): 2 Wigwam Flats-Elko-Phillips, 3 Elk Valley East, 4 Elk Valley West, 5 Bull River, 6 Premier-Wildhorse, 7 Whiteswan-Sharktooth, 8 Columbia Lake-Radium, and 9 Assiniboine (Fig. 1). Ground counts were used to supplement aerial survey data in several areas, and Alberta survey data from January 2018 were used for estimates at Crowsnest Pass (PMU 3; M. Didkowsky, Alberta Environment and Parks, unpubl. data). Bighorn sheep in the Kootenay Region are generally divided into those that use lower elevation winter ranges within the Rocky Mountain Trench – escaping deep snow at higher elevations by using grassland or open forested habitats on flat or southerly aspects associated with rocky escape terrain – and those that use higher-elevation winter ranges – using mid- to high-elevation grassland habitats on windswept, southerly facing slopes again associated with escape terrain (Kuzuk et al. 2012, Stent et al. 2013). The study area included low elevation slopes along the east side of the Rocky Mountain Trench and mid to high elevation slopes (alpine and open subalpine habitat) within the Rocky Mountains. These areas cover a range of biogeoclimatic zones: Interior Douglas Fir, Engelmann Spruce Subalpine Fir, Montane Spruce, Ponderosa Pine, Interior Cedar Hemlock and Alpine Tundra (Braumandl and Curran 2002). Potential predators of bighorn sheep in the study area include grizzly bear (Ursus arctos), black bear (U. americanus), cougar (Puma concolor), wolverine (Gulo gulo), wolf (Canis lupus), coyote (C. latrans), and golden eagle (Aquila chrysaetos). The area also supports a high density and diversity of other ungulates, including large numbers of elk (Cervus elaphus) and mule deer (Odocoileus hemionus), scattered mountain goat (Oreamnos americanus), and smaller numbers of moose (Alces alces) and white-tailed deer (O. virginianus). Mountain goat and elk were often observed during winter on the same ranges utilized by sheep. Aurora Wildlife Research Page 1 East Kootenay bighorn sheep surveys 2019 Figure 1. Population

(250) 825-4063; e-mail: [email protected] May 2013 Elk Valley bighorn sheep project Executive summary Winter is a critical season for most mountain ungulates, which use a variety of strategies to cope with burial of preferred forage and increased cost of locomotion in snow. Rocky Mountain bighorn sheep (Ovis canadensis canadensis) inhabit the east side of the Elk Valley in southeastern British Columbia where forestry and 4 large, open-pit coal mines are in operation. Sheep in this area generally winter at high elevation on windswept, south-facing native grasslands, with some sheep also wintering on mine properties. Expansion of coal mining is proposed in portions of the valley which may result in direct loss of high-elevation winter range, which in some instances can result in the creation of winter habitat through reclamation of mine disturbance. Winter range may be the single most important factor limiting sheep populations in the area. The primary objectives of this study were to describe seasonal movements, winter habitat selection, and use of mine properties by this population. A concurrent companion study examined winter range plant communities and plant production, range condition, and winter diet.
